What Is Memory Care?
Memory care provides round-the-clock help for people with Alzheimer’s or other forms of dementia. These settings focus on safety, with secure doors and layouts that reduce wandering. Staff get special training to handle memory issues, like confusion or mood changes. Activities spark joy and keep minds active, such as music sessions or simple games. In Keizer, many spots mix this with local touches, like views of the Willamette River. Families value the peace knowing their loved one stays engaged and protected.
How to Choose Memory Care in Keizer
Picking memory care involves looking at staff ratios, activity plans, and building design. Visit during mealtimes to see interactions. Ask about handling tough behaviors gently. Check if they offer in-home care options for transitions. Location counts too, with Keizer’s quiet neighborhoods a plus. Think about future needs, like if they’ll need assisted living. Talk to current families for real insights. This step ensures a good match.

FAQ
What makes memory care different from assisted living in Keizer?
Memory care adds extra security and staff training for dementia. It focuses on routines that aid recall, unlike general assisted living. Both offer daily help, but memory spots tailor more to cognitive needs. This keeps residents safe and content.
How do I know if my loved one needs memory care now?
Look for signs like frequent confusion or safety risks at home. If in-home care isn’t enough, memory care steps in with structure. Talk to doctors for advice. Early moves often ease adjustments.
Can memory care include short stays in Keizer?
Yes, some spots offer respite for brief periods. This helps caregivers rest or test the fit. Check with places like adult foster homes for options. It gives a taste without full commit.
What activities help in Keizer memory care?
Common ones are music, art, and gentle exercise. They spark memories and lift spirits. Local touches, like river views, add calm. Programs adjust to each person for best results.
